Ride the historic Great Southern Rail Trail as well as a day on the stunning Bass Coast Trail in beautiful South Gippsland Victoria, Australia.

Ride this epic trail from start to finish over 4 days with quality accommodation, meals, guide, support in a fun, small group social atmosphere.

Enjoy views of Wilsons Promontory and Quiet Corner. Spot wildlife throughout your ride including koalas, kangaroos and more. Laze at the many cafes, relive your riding at a classic Aussie Pub or a local restaurant.

We start with a wonderful first day riding the easy and coastal Bass Coast Trail after tranferring from Melojrne. From day 2 we ride from the new start of the Great Southern Rail Trail in Nyora to the newly extended end section at Yarram, so you will ride the full length of this beautiful cycling trail.

Track: Compacted gravel surface, fine gravel suitable for most bikes and riders and a joy to ride!
